How It Works
How It Works
Mastering the Change Curve is based upon years of research, experience, and the Kubler-Ross grief model. Using a current change initiative as a frame of reference, individuals respond to a series of 24 statements that describe responses to change, choosing from a five-point scale of "Almost Totally True" to "Almost Totally Untrue." The soft-skills assessment identifies which change phase the individual is currently experiencing, and it also provides sub-scores in each of the dimensions.
Mastering the Change Curve takes approximately 10 minutes to complete, and we recommend you allow one to two hours for the interpretation of results, debriefing, and action planning.

Author Info
Author Info
Dr. Cynthia Scott is a founding principal of Changeworks Global, a recognized leader with more than 20 years of experience in the fields of strategic planning for human capital management, managing continual organizational change, and visionary leadership. She is the author of numerous books, including Rekindling Commitment and Take This Work and Love It! and her work has been featured in publications such as The Wall Street Journal, Business Week, the Stanford Business School Newsletter, and Worthwhile Magazine.
Dr. Dennis Jaffe is a founding principal of Changeworks Global and director of the Organizational Inquiry Program at Saybrook Graduate School. He is a nationally recognized leader in the field of organizational development and earned his Ph.D. in sociology and MA in management from Yale University. His professional training is in organizational development, and he is also a licensed clinical psychologist. Dr. Jaffe is the author of 22 books, including Rekindling Commitment and Organizational Vision, Values, and Mission.
